Today I shall show you a box that I have made with embossed metallic tape.
I cut the embossed tape into pieces which I covered over the box.
I decided to antique my metal with a coat of black acrylic paint. I wiped of the excess and sanded the surface a bit.
I added a key and a "lock" that I first heat embossed with copper embossing pouder, then I added a little silver Inka Gold.
I also added a chain, laces, paper cut outs, metal corners, flowers with Gesso and some other items from my stash.
